I Never Received Any Private Jet From Any Eminent Nigerian – Peter Obi

ENUGU, Nigeria (VOICE OF NAIJA)- Mr. Peter Obi, the presidential candidate of the Labour Party (LP), has denied receiving personal jets to boost his campaign, for the 2023 election.

Reports had it that some eminent Nigerians donated personal jets to Obi’s presidential campaign.

Reacting to the reports, the former Anambra State Governor described such viral claims as false.

In a series of tweets on Sunday , Obi wrote: “Recently, several social media reports have alluded that some eminent Nigerians have donated their personal jets for my use during my campaign.

“In as much as I appreciate the expression of such hopes, I have never received any of such offer.”

The former APGA member, prayed that God would bless those “eminent Nigerians.”

He also wished that they are not distracted by such remarks.

“I pray that those eminent Nigerians mentioned, are not unduly distracted by such social media utterances.

“May God Almighty bless those eminent Nigerians always,” he added.
